Flint Soup

Flint Soup focuses on building community and small businesses in the city of Flint, MI in the United States. Their activities center around a monthly dinner that raises seed money for start-ups in the Flint community. Local entrepreneurs pitch their businesses to the group and all the money raised through the monthly dinner gets allocated to the entrepreneur with the most compelling pitch. It's just $5 for soup, salad, bread, and a vote!
